Estimate the area of the top of a drum that has a radius of 14 inches
Anit [1.1K]
The equation for the area of a circle (as most drums are) is 
A= π · r² 
so knowing the radius to be 14, plug that in for r and A=196π, or about 615.4 inches squared

If f(x) = 4x + 12 is graphed on a coordinate plane, what is the yintercept of the graph?
Aneli [31]

Answer:

12

Step-by-step explanation:

this equation is in slope intercept form which is

y=mx+b

you just have to remember that m is your slope and b is your y intercept

therefore, the y intercept is 12
